Florida Panthers star forward Matthew Tkachuk wasn't out for long after exiting midway through the first period of the Stanley Cup Final Game 3 clash against the Vegas Golden Knights on Thursday in Sunrise, Fla.
Tkachuk was on the receiving end of a clean, open-ice shoulder-to-shoulder check from Keegan Kolesar of the Golden Knights with 5:56 left in the period.
Despite stumbling as he tried to get to his feet, Tkachuk went to the bench. He was on the ice for a power-play shift soon afterward. However, he went to the dressing room afterwards.
After being attended to, Tkachuk rejoined his team on the bench a few minutes into the second period and reentered the game.
Tkachuk has collected 10 goals and 22 points in 19 playoff games.
Vegas held a 2-0 lead in the best-of-seven series.
